How to Become a Farm Worker
Everything you need to know about breaking into a career as a Farm Worker in Victoria.
Qualifications Required
- Physical fitness for outdoor work
- Driver's license
- Willingness to work variable hours
- Certificate II or III in Agriculture
- Experience with specific machinery
- Chemical handling certification
Career Progression
Farm Hand
Experienced Farm Worker
Farm Supervisor
Farm Manager / Owner
Skills in Demand
Tips for Breaking In
- 1Develop multiple skills (cropping, livestock, machinery)
- 2Get formal qualifications for management positions
- 3Consider agricultural contracting for higher earnings
- 4Mining and pastoral stations often offer premium pay
- 5Share farming can be path to ownership

About Farm Worker Salaries in Geelong
The average Farm Worker in Geelong, Victoria earns $45,240 per year, or approximately $23 per hour. Salaries typically range from $36,540 for entry-level positions to $59,160 for senior roles with extensive experience.
After income tax, Medicare levy, and other deductions, a Farm Worker earning the average salary in Geelong can expect to take home approximately $39,976 per year, or $3,331 per month.
Geelong is home to approximately 270,000 people and has a cost of living index of 80 (where Sydney = 100). This means living costs in Geelong are lower Sydney.
